How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mountain Center?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 92561 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,248 | $883 | $6,000 |
| 92561 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,212 | $959 | $4,305 |
| 92561 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,783 | $1,014 | $4,372 |

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 92561?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 92561 range from $2,000 to $3,049,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$959 to $4,305.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,014 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,322.
